1  MamboHacks.com / Mambo-SMF Forum 1.3.0 Support / Problem with login module 1.3a on: May 03, 2005, 08:49:25 AM
I am having a problem with the login module when running Mambo-SMF 1.3. I've done the component and SMF package installs without any problems, and everything is patched / configured and working as far as the integration goes. However, the Login Module shows all manner of errors on any page other than the forum's page, on which it works perfectly.

Some of the errors I get are listed below...

Warning: mysql_query(): supplied argument is not a valid MySQL-Link resource in D:\Site\forums\Sources\Subs.php on line 232

Warning: mysql_fetch_row(): supplied argument is not a valid MySQL result resource in D:\Site\forums\Sources\Load.php on line 40

Warning: mysql_free_result(): supplied argument is not a valid MySQL result resource in D:\Site\forums\Sources\Load.php on line 42
2  MamboHacks.com / Mambo-SMF Forum 1.3.0 Support / Two bugs in 1.30 installation on: April 26, 2005, 07:17:18 AM
I've hit three problems in installing the 1.30 beta version.

First, SMF won't install the mod correctly, it fails on patching the sources/profile.php file (or at least it thinks it fails) - however, the file actually does get patched correctly.

Second, when I try to go to the forums from Mambo, I get "Constant WIRELESS already defined in <path to SMF>\index.php on line 78"

EDIT: Having just un-installed and re-installed SMF completely (using the same database) everything now works - it seems it was upgrading that it didn't like...
